Little known Brexit-related rule to stop Marcus Rashford following Kyle Walker to AC Milan
Share this @internewscast.com

Marcus Rashford looks set to be denied a move to AC Milan.

The Manchester United winger has been heavily rumored to depart from Old Trafford, with talkSPORT earlier indicating that AC Milan has escalated their interest in signing him.

However, with the seven-time European champions instead making Kyle Walker their priority, Rashford will likely have to look elsewhere.

Due to Serie A registration regulations, Milan can only acquire one of the two English players. TalkSPORT reveals that Walker is poised to be confirmed as joining on loan from Manchester City, with an option for a permanent transfer.

Clubs are only permitted to register a maximum of two new non-EU players to their squad each season.

That number is limited to one unless a non-EU player leaves the club during the campaign.

With the United Kingdom leaving the European Union in 2020, English players are classed as non-EU in Serie A.

This situation means Milan can presently register either Rashford or Walker, forcing the Manchester United star to explore opportunities elsewhere.

talkSPORT understands that Borussia Dortmund sporting director Sebastian Kehl has held a meeting with Rashford’s representatives, while Barcelona, Juventus and Monaco are said to be interested.

The Bundesliga side are understood to be exploring a loan deal until the end of the season.

Rashford hasn’t played football since he gave a bombshell interview to talkSPORT contributor Henry Winter on December 17, saying he’s ‘ready for a new challenge’.

Yet with just a week left of the January window, Rashford is yet to find that new challenge, and former Crystal Palace owner Simon Jordan thinks it’s on the player.
